What a mental health crisis looks like in the actual world
People ask what is a mental health crisis and just how to understand when to action in. The response is context driven. A dilemma can be severe suicidality, extreme panic with impaired performance, psychosis with disorganised behavior, or an unexpected trauma feedback. The thread that ties these with each other impends danger to self or others, or a degree of disability that avoids a person from conference fundamental needs in the moment.
In a storehouse setup, an employee might throw tools throughout a panic attack. In an institution, a trainee may withdraw completely and quit reacting after a distressing disclosure. In a client service atmosphere, an employee may share hopelessness and hint at self injury after an efficiency evaluation. None of these circumstances sit nicely inside one medical diagnosis, yet all can call for a gauged crisis mental health response.
The 11379NAT mental health course offers you a decision tree for these moments. It helps you observe what matters: declarations of intent, access to methods, anxiety, alignment, capacity to authorization, and instant security hazards. You find out to evaluate seriousness, then pick the least invasive choice that keeps everyone safe.

What you in fact discover: skills you will certainly use on day one
The heart of excellent training is transferability. After the emergency treatment mental health course, you should have the ability to stroll back into your work environment and react in a different way the exact same day. Right here is what that resembles in practice.
You will know how to open up a conversation without catching the person. You will practice phrases that show care without making assurances you can not maintain. Your body movement will certainly transform. You will certainly quit blocking exits, you will certainly gauge your distance, and you will certainly enjoy your hands.
You will certainly have a checklist in your go to suicidality. You will inquire about intent, strategy, means, duration, previous attempts, and protective variables. You will do it simply, without euphemisms, since unclear inquiries lead to vague answers.
You will certainly comprehend psychosis warnings. If somebody reports listening to a voice regulating action, you will certainly discover web content and controllability before deciding whether to intensify. If you see disorientation or sudden fear, you will concentrate on environmental calm and selections rather than confrontation.
You will certainly boost your referrals. Rather than informing a person to see a GENERAL PRACTITIONER, you will certainly supply to call the center with each other and publication a time, or link them to an EAP in the area. You will certainly know the best numbers for situation lines and when to step up to emergency situation services.


You will document realities. "Customer mentioned 'I really feel hazardous at home, I concealed in the shower room for two hours'" is both more clear and more secure than "customer seemed distressed." The course will instruct what to record, what to leave out, and exactly how to save notes in accordance with privacy law.

First aid for mental wellness in the workplace
Plenty of groups already have physical first aiders. Integrating first aid for mental health is a logical following step. The operational challenge is developing a clear boundary between the two without siloing. I recommend coupling rosters to make sure that at the very least one physical first aid officer and one mental health support officer get on each change. Train them with each other on incident flow so they recognize when to call each various other in. As an example, a panic episode can imitate a clinical concern, and a hypoglycemic event can resemble confusion from psychosis. Cross recognition avoids the wrong response.
It helps to embed straightforward signage and quick referral cards near emergency treatment kits. Include crisis lines, local severe care numbers, and standard do nots: do not restrain unless there is immediate threat to life, do not threaten effects, do not promise discretion you can not maintain. Keep the tone useful, not clinical.
Documentation and privacy: little mistakes, large consequences
An usual discomfort factor in crisis mental health course training is documents. Over share and you risk violations. Under share and you leave the next responder blind. The sensible wonderful spot looks like this: stay with observable realities and direct quotes, capture risk indications and actions taken, log who you notified and when, and note concurred following actions. Prevent supposition, medical diagnosis labels, or subjective adjectives. Shop documents where your plan states they belong, not in individual note pads or straight messages.
If in doubt, ask your privacy police officer or human resources. The regulation does not expect perfection, it anticipates sensible actions to protect sensitive information and to share on a need to understand basis. A well created emergency treatment for mental health course will pierce this up until it becomes habit.
